Why does low self-esteem intensify the impact of the various influences on teen decision making?
Teens with high levels of self-esteem are confident and self-assured, so when they face a tough decision such as whether to use illegal drugs, this self-assurance allows them to make decisions independently. Teens with low self-esteem are not confident and often doubt themselves and their decision making. When teens with low self-esteem need to make tough decisions, they will look to outside influence to guide, suggest, or validate their decisions.

What is the link between identity self image and self esteem?
Identity, self-image, and self-esteem are interconnected aspects of an individual's self-concept. Identity refers to a person's sense of who they are, self-image is how they see themselves, and self-esteem is the value they place on themselves. A positive self-image and high self-esteem are often rooted in a strong, coherent sense of identity.

What is a self demagnetization?
Self demagnetization occurs when a magnetic material loses its magnetic properties over time due to factors such as exposure to high temperatures, physical stress, or external magnetic fields. This results in a decrease in the material's ability to attract or hold a magnetic charge.

What is self perception theory and how does it increase your ability to predict behaviour?
Self-perception theory proposes that individuals determine their attitudes and emotions by observing their own behavior. By understanding one's own actions and reactions, one can make more accurate predictions about their future behavior in similar situations. This theory emphasizes the role of self-awareness in shaping behavior and attitudes, allowing individuals to better anticipate their actions based on past observations of themselves.

The feared self is a concept in psychology referring to the aspects of oneself that an individual may be afraid of, such as failures, insecurities, or weaknesses. It represents the negative or undesirable traits that a person may be reluctant to acknowledge or confront, often leading to feelings of anxiety or avoidance. Recognizing and accepting the feared self is an important step in personal growth and self-improvement.
